coe-2023.pngIt could take months or even years for an ADHD assessment through the NHS. This is due to a shortage of specialists and the high demand for services.

Private clinics offer a more efficient and more complete option than the NHS. These assessments are typically conducted by a clinical psychologist or psychiatrist.

Psychiatrists

A Psychiatrist is a seasoned doctor who specializes in mental health and is able to diagnose ADHD. They can assist you in managing your symptoms and improve the quality of your life. They can also provide treatment options that include stimulant medications or behavioural therapy. These treatments are efficient in treating ADHD symptoms, such as impulsivity and poor organisation. You can also try dietary modifications and other natural remedies to treat ADHD. But, it is important to consult with a physician prior to commencing any treatment.

If you think that you may have ADHD, the first step is to speak to your GP. They should be able to take you seriously and refer you to an NHS adult ADHD service. If they don't, ask them to refer you to another GP. You can also contact your specialist NHS adult ADHD service directly. They will inform you of what their waiting times are and how to get them.

During the ADHD assessment, a psychiatrist will question you about your symptoms and your past behavior and. They will also go over any questionnaires you've completed and conduct a thorough interview. They will then discuss the results of the ADHD test and what they mean for you. The test is expected to last between 90 and 120 minutes.

The signs of ADHD in adults are often difficult to recognize and may lead to incorrect diagnosis. Medical professionals often have prejudices against certain groups of people with ADHD. These prejudices can make it more difficult for people to get an accurate diagnosis and the appropriate treatment. This is particularly true for people who are of color, those born females, and non-native English speaking people.

Taking an ADHD test is an excellent way to determine if you have the condition. The results will indicate whether you require further testing and treatment. If you need medication you'll need to consult your GP will issue a prescription for it. You may also discuss your medical condition with a psychiatrist at an in-house clinic that is a great alternative if you wish to avoid lengthy wait times for an appointment.

Psychologists

ADHD can present a number of difficulties in adulthood. It can impact on your work, relationships, and overall well-being. In some cases, adults with ADHD have been experiencing symptoms since childhood but may not have been diagnosed until they were younger. If you suspect you may have ADHD A professional can help you at one of London's best clinics.

Our specialists are all experts in diagnosing ADHD in adults. They can evaluate the severity of your condition, discuss treatment options and consult with a psychotherapist for additional support. They follow the diagnostic guidance provided by NICE that takes into account of both DSM-5 and ICD-10 guidelines. Referrals are considered starting at the age of 18 and, in some cases, as early as 17.

In the initial evaluation the psychiatrist who is your consultant will review the questionnaires you've completed. They will also conduct a detailed interview with you. During the interview, they'll inquire about your symptoms and the impacts on your daily functioning. They'll also look at your mental health history as well as any other mental illnesses you may be suffering from.

It is important to prepare for the assessment process, which can take two sessions. It's a good idea to bring some notes to your appointment, for example, a list of symptoms that you're experiencing. It's also recommended to bring an individual from your family or a close friend with you for assistance.

A private ADHD assessment is typically PS1,335 and will include both the initial 1hr assessment session as well as the second session of 2 hours. It's worth asking your insurance company to determine whether this is covered.

A person suffering from ADHD can have a positive effect on their life when it's taken care of. They can be successful in the business world and possess a lot of energy, vitality and creativity. But, it's important to note that ADHD can lead to mental and medical conditions like anxiety, depression as well as alcohol and drug abuse. It's important to get a correct diagnosis from a qualified professional.

Psychotherapists

An experienced psychotherapist can help you overcome the issues that arise from ADHD. They can offer strategies to help you cope with symptoms, like impulsive behavior and inattentiveness. They can also offer advice on how to manage your symptoms and increase your quality of life. It is important to remember that psychotherapy doesn't treat ADHD directly. It can be used to supplement other treatments. For instance, certain patients with ADHD may benefit from a combination of medication as well as behavioural therapy.

The best way to get an accurate diagnosis of ADHD is to conduct a professional assessment. These assessments can be conducted in person or online. They are usually brief and require you to complete a questionnaire that rates your behavior in various social situations. The test may also include questions about your family history and any other mental health issues.

You can also invite a friend for the test to help answer some questions. This will increase the reliability of the test. The test will last up to 1.5 hours and could include an online test called QbCheck and a clinical interview. It is crucial to bring any old school reports you have, as these will be helpful in determining whether you suffer from ADHD.

If you decide to have an assessment, make sure you select a psychiatrist or psychologist with experience in treating ADHD. Counsellors and other mental health professionals are not competent to diagnose ADHD. If you're diagnosed with ADHD, a psychiatrist or psychologist can prescribe medication to treat the condition. A diagnosis of ADHD is required to obtain insurance and protections at work.

The BBC's investigation revealed that many private adhd assessment west yorkshire clinics are giving out inaccurate diagnoses of ADHD. These diagnoses can be incorrect and have serious consequences for patients. If you're considering undergoing an ADHD assessment, make sure that the clinic is accredited by the Royal College of Psychiatrists.
